Assuming you’ve had your tent contribute to the tech space for some time, you ought to realize that everybody discusses “the cloud.” About 10 years prior, it was somewhat of an IT popular expression. Presently? Cloud programming advancement is the following stage in business programming development, and the numbers don’t lie.
89% of ventures as of now utilize a multi-cloud technique, with 80% utilizing a mixture approach, consolidating private and public mists.
Yet, here’s the place where it gets fascinating. 57% of these endeavors are relocating more jobs to the cloud.
Distributed computing permits organizations to safely store and offer information. It likewise assists associations with creating, conveying, and scaling applications rapidly while getting to work across groups progressively. Therefore, organizations are beginning to move from on-reason to cloud-based programming improvement models.
This article will examine all you want to be familiar with distributed computing and cloud programming advancement to kick you off.
What is distributed computing?
Distributed computing depicts a scope of figuring administrations or frameworks presented by cloud specialist organizations to clients over the web. These administrations or frameworks incorporate programming, servers, capacity, organizing, insight, investigation, and information bases to give quicker advancement, and adaptability, and lessen functional expenses.
Organizations and advancement groups that utilize distributed computing never again need to keep up with their own foundation for programming improvement. All things considered, they can “lease” these registering assets from cloud merchants and use them on request.
These “rentable” assets are of three sorts:
SaaS – Software-as-a-Service conveys cloud programming that clients can access over the web without introducing or keeping up with them. Slack, MailChimp, and Salesforce, for instance.
PaaS – Platform-as-a-Service gives a cloud application improvement structure for engineers to construct or make modified programming. The assets you can get in this class are figuring, data set, memory, capacity, and so forth. PaaS suppliers incorporate Windows Azure and AWS, among numerous others.
IaaS – Infrastructure-as-a-Service has an enormous scope processing framework on the cloud, similar to capacity, virtual servers, and organizations for endeavors. Outsider cloud sellers or more modest organizations lease or rent this foundation to run their web applications or working frameworks without accumulating working or upkeep costs. IaaS merchants incorporate Google Compute Engine, Azure Virtual Machines, and AWS EC2.
The advances you’ll utilize will rely intensely upon your business needs.
For designers, PaaS is sought after as it allows groups to work together on projects productively. Then again, endeavor clients are bound to sign with IaaS and SaaS suppliers. Endeavor clients conclude what they need and pay for assets as they use them, saving forthright expenses of buying actual foundations or devices.
What are the upsides of cloud programming improvement?
There are many justifications for why you ought to take on cloud programming advancement.
First of all, it is a fantastic option in contrast to the conventional on-premise framework. To the side, cloud programming advancement makes it more straightforward to create and send vigorous programming without huge upward expenses, expanding business execution and working with development.
How about we look at a portion of these benefits to see better why engineers and organizations are moving to the cloud?
1. Cost-viability
You can increase your business by relying upon your necessities without causing the expenses of dealing with your servers. Cloud specialist co-ops have their own DevOps groups. You don’t have to recruit an enormous group to keep up with your cloud framework to keep everything moving along as expected.
Keeping up with an on-premise foundation is tedious and expensive, with security fixes and working framework refreshes. Embracing cloud programming improvement guarantees your group can zero in on more basic errands, for example, application advancement and client service.
Additionally, distributed computing stockpiling empowers you to have applications on far-off servers, saving you the migraine of equipment-related costs.
2. Usability
Fabricating and keeping an in-house framework can be testing, particularly for independent companies without a devoted IT office. You can get to distributed computing stages from any gadget that has a web association, including workstations, workstations, tablets, and cell phones.
Follow clients appreciate consistent use, including admittance to all application logs from one spot across the entirety of their applications and servers.
As the brought-together logging highlight totals every one of your logs into one spot, you can move began immediately without learning convoluted frameworks or cycles.
3. Versatility
Assuming that your business develops, your cloud applications can develop with it.
Cloud stages can assist you with scaling more really than customary stages since you can deal with expanded use by dispensing assets as indicated by current interest. You pay for what you use and can build your utilization flawlessly depending on the situation.
Cloud arrangements are reasonable for ventures that change or heighten the interest in registering power. You can increase your cloud limit without putting resources into actual hardware as your business develops. Organizations that utilize distributed computing might acquire a huge upper hand in view of their adaptability.
Highlights of cloud computing
Distributed computing permits you to zero in on your center business capacities while utilizing cloud suppliers’ skills to convey your product on the web and cell phones.
You’re not confined to a solitary working framework or gadget, and you’re not answerable for server upkeep or application refreshes.
As displayed beneath, cloud administrations’ adaptability and their steadily extending assortment of devices and innovations have accelerated reception across businesses. Cloud innovation permits you to have more proficient figuring by incorporating stockpiling, memory, handling, and limit.
Here is a rundown of the standard elements of distributed computing to remember. Includes likewise decide why organizations and engineers pick one cloud programming stage over another.
1. Multi-tenure
Multi-occupancy is a product design in which a solitary occurrence serves a huge number. While working in a similar shared climate, a huge number can have similar programming, equipment, information capacity, and different assets. The information of each inhabitant is isolated from that of different clients.
Multi-occupancy can decrease costs, equipment necessities, and upkeep costs, further develop server reaction time and have a lesser ecological effect. By permitting a few clients to get to a similar example without losing execution or security, multi-occupancy makes distributed computing available to little and medium organizations.
2. Self-administration
Cloud items are self-overhauled, implying that you can begin involving them without trusting that anybody will arrange and test the product for you. You get a good deal on executing the assistance in your business.
For instance, you can go onto a site, register their subtleties, and quickly access the product. You might decide to get to email confirmation instruments first, then add different elements as your business needs change. At the point when cloud programming is open through a versatile application, there is a compelling reason need to introduce or refresh the product on every client’s gadget or PC.
3. Pay more only as costs arise, model,
Many cloud merchants give adaptable valuing models that permit organizations to pay just for the assets they use or require. Endeavors can increase their advancement in light of their requirements without burning through much cash in IT framework supervisory crews.
Clients pay just for the administrations they consume, giving them more noteworthy adaptability in the amount they use and spend. You can likewise begin little as you test new applications and afterward scale them as your business develops.
4. Quality help
Distributed computing depends on an outsider facilitating your applications over the web without gathering functional and support costs. The facilitating organization pays for the gear expected to run your product and any upkeep or overhauls required. You won’t need to stress over any of those costs, you’ll in any case have the option to involve assistance for your business needs.
Cloud suppliers put widely in quality control tests, checking, and different strategies to guarantee an elevated degree of administration. Cloud suppliers additionally save excess frameworks set up for information security and catastrophe recuperation. Assuming that one framework fizzles, different dominates, bringing about more reliable administrations than those you could set up yourself.
With Retrace, for instance, you can recognize application execution issues prior and tackle them quickly. Your group can distinguish and fix any issues inside your set-up of work the board apparatuses before the end clients even notice.